Starting to hunt as an adult can feel overwhelming. In this episode, we break down the biggest challenges adult-onset hunters face—gear overload, confusing regulations, access to land, confidence at the range, and the anxiety of doing it “wrong.” Most importantly, we explain why finding a hunting mentor is the fastest, safest way to build real-world skills and enjoy the woods sooner.

What we cover:

Whether you’re chasing your first whitetail, hiking into elk country, or starting with small game, this episode gives new hunters a clear path forward and a mentor-focused game plan to shorten the learning curve.

If you’re an experienced hunter, we also share how to mentor responsibly and help grow the hunting community.
